Product Attributes
- Product Status: Active
- Core Processor: ARM® Cortex®-A5
- Number of Cores/Bus Width: 1 Core, 32-Bit
- Speed: 500MHz
- Co-Processors/DSP: Multimedia; NEON™ MPE
- RAM Controllers: LPDDR1, LPDDR2, LPDDR3, DDR2, DDR3, DDR3L, QSPI
- Graphics Acceleration: Yes
- Display & Interface Controllers: Keyboard, LCD, Touchscreen
- Ethernet: 10/100Mbps (1)
- SATA: -
- USB: USB 2.0 + HSIC
- Voltage - I/O: 3.3V
- Operating Temperature: -40°C ~ 105°C (TA)
- Security Features: ARM TZ, Boot Security, Cryptography, RTIC, Secure Fusebox, Secure JTAG, Secure Memory, Secure RTC
- Package / Case: 289-LFBGA
- Supplier Device Package: 289-LFBGA (14x14)
